Ronny Simon (page 18)

Ronny was once the owner of the second largest privately owned roofing company in the USA. A diagnosis of epilepsy and the mounting stress of his successful company caused him to shut down his business. But he's still working very hard to raise funds that will one day lead to a cure for epilepsy.
